AIM Autosport returns to competition this weekend
Debut race for new partner, Pacific Mobile™


Woodbridge, Ontario  (2010.03.01) This weekend at Homestead-Miami Speedway, AIM Autosport will launch its 2010 racing season in the No. 61 Ford Riley at the Grand Prix of Miami with drivers Burt Frisselle and Mark Wilkins.  This will also be the first of a two race primary sponsorship by Pacific Mobile™, a division of Canadian based company Pacific Group™ Inc. Pacific Mobile™ specializes in Bluetooth accessories for mobile devices.
 
The No 61 Ford Riley will roll off the trailer at Homestead sporting a brand new livery designed by Pacific Group’s brand strategy and industrial design division, Pacific Creative Group. The intricate design is quite unique and unlike anything you would expect on a racecar. AIM and Pacific Mobile™ enlisted the assistance of Beyond Digital Imaging, experts in vinyl wrap systems, to take the new livery from concept to completion.

AIM took the car to Carolina Motorsport Park (CMP) last week for some shakedown testing. They had the advantage of Burt and Mark both racing on the new 2010 Pirelli tire during the Rolex 24 at Daytona and being able to provide additional feedback. The test was deemed a success and drivers, crew and team principals are all looking forward to getting to Homestead for the race this weekend.
 
The Pacific Mobile™ No. 61 Ford Riley is currently in Fort Pierce, Florida being prepared for this coming weekend’s race, the Grand Prix of Miami at Homestead-Miami Speedway on March 6th. The race will be broadcast live on SPEED TV starting 5:00 p.m. ET.  The race will also be aired live on the Motor Racing Network (MRN) and streamed live online. Established in 1995 with a mandate to identify, train and manage emerging motorsport talent AIM operates multi-car teams competing in the Formula BMW USA Championship and the Star Mazda Series North American Championship. Among those drivers who have graduated from AIM Autosport are former series and rookie champions james hinchcliffe, Andrew Ranger, Andrew Bordin, J.F.Veilleux, Jonathan Macri, L.P. Dumoulin, Anthony Simone and Dan Burchill. Other notable AIM graduates include, Sam Hornish Jr., Billy Asaro, mark wilkins, Ashley Taws, Paul Dana, Tom Dyer, Josh Schreiber, Dan McMullen and Antoine Bessette.
